This chapter provides information about the port adapters and service adapters common to the Cisco 7000 family. The information is organized into the following sections:
The Cisco 7200 series routers support ATM, 100VG-AnyLAN, Ethernet 10BaseT and 10BaseFL, Fast Ethernet 100BaseTX and 100BaseFX, Token Ring, Fiber Distributed Data Interface (FDDI), High-Speed Serial Interface (HSSI), and synchronous serial media.
The Cisco 7200 series routers support multiprotocol, multimedia routing and bridging with a wide variety of protocols and any combination of ATM, ATM-Circuit Emulation Services (ATM-CES), Ethernet 10BaseT and 10BaseFL, Fast Ethernet 100BaseTX and 100BaseFX, Token Ring, FDDI, HSSI, ISDN PRI and BRI, and synchronous serial media. Network interfaces reside on port and service adapters that provide a connection between the routers' Peripheral Component Interconnect (PCI) buses and external networks. Port and service adapters can be placed in any available port adapter slot, in any desired combination.
The following sections describe the current port adapters and service adapters available for the Cisco 7000 family.

The ATM OC3 port adapters are single-port (SC duplex connectors), OC-3c (155 Mbps) ATM port adapters for the Cisco 7500 series, Cisco 7000 series, and Cisco 7200 series routers. The ATM OC3 port adapters are intended for campus, private network, and intra-POP ATM applications with fiber cable lengths up to 15 km. Cisco IOS Release 11.1(9)CA is required for the ATM OC3 port adapters.

The ISDN BRI port adapters provide ISDN BRI interfaces for connecting Cisco 7200 series routers to an ISDN wide-area network through an NT1 device. Each interface consists of two B channels that can transmit and receive data at the rate of 64 kbps, full-duplex, and one D channel that can transmit and receive data at the rate of 16 kbps, full-duplex.

The channelized T1/ISDN PRI port adapter provides up to two channelized T1 or ISDN PRI interfaces. Each interface can transmit and receive data bidirectionally at the T1 rate of 1.544 Mbps. The channelized T1/ISDN PRI port adapter is available for Cisco 7500 series, Cisco 7000 series, and Cisco 7200 series routers.

The channelized E1/ISDN PRI port adapters provide up to two channelized E1 or ISDN PRI interfaces. Each interface can transmit and receive data bidirectionally at the E1 rate of 2.048 Mbps. The channelized E1/ISDN PRI port adapters are available for Cisco 7500 series, Cisco 7000 series, and Cisco 7200 series routers.

The Ethernet 10BaseT port adapters provide IEEE 802.3 Ethernet 10BaseT interfaces. Each interface allows a maximum bandwidth of 10 Mbps, for a maximum aggregate bandwidth of 40 Mbps. All ports run at line (wire) speed. The Ethernet 10BaseT port adapters are available for Cisco 7500 series, Cisco 7000 series, and Cisco 7200 series routers.

The Ethernet 10BaseFL port adapter provides up to five IEEE 802.3 Ethernet 10BaseFL interfaces. Each interface allows a maximum bandwidth of 10 Mbps, for a maximum aggregate bandwidth of 50 Mbps, half-duplex. Each interface uses two multimode (ST) receptacles for receive (RX) and transmit (TX). All five ports run at line (wire) speed. The Ethernet 10BaseFL port adapter is available for Cisco 7500 series, Cisco 7000 series, and Cisco 7200 series routers.

The Fast Ethernet port adapters provide a 100-Mbps, 100BaseT Fast Ethernet interface. Both full-duplex and half-duplex operation are supported for the Fast Ethernet port adapters. The Fast Ethernet port adapters are available for Cisco 7500 series, Cisco 7000 series, and Cisco 7200 series routers.

The PA-4T+ enhanced 4-port synchronous serial port adapter provides up to four of the following electrical interfaces: EIA/TIA-232, EIA/TIA-449, EIA-530. X.21, and V.35. Each interface complies with its specific interface specifications. The cable attached to each synchronous serial port adapter's interface ports determines its type (EIA/TIA-232, and so forth) and its mode (DCE or DTE). The enhanced 4-port synchronous serial port adapters are available for Cisco 7500 series, Cisco 7000 series, and Cisco 7200 series routers.

The synchronous serial V.35 port adapter provides up to eight V.35 synchronous serial interfaces through a single port that has a 200-pin, Molex receptacle. Each interface provides full-duplex operation at T1 (1.544 Mbps) and E1 (2.048 Mbps) speeds. The synchronous serial V.35 port adapters are available for Cisco 7500 series, Cisco 7000 series, and Cisco 7200 series routers.

The synchronous serial X.21 port adapter provides up to eight X.21 synchronous serial interfaces through a single port that has a 200-pin, Molex receptacle. Each interface provides full-duplex operation at T1 (1.544 Mbps) and E1 (2.048 Mbps) speeds. The synchronous serial X.21 port adapters are available for Cisco 7500 series, Cisco 7000 series, and Cisco 7200 series routers.

The synchronous serial EIA/TIA-232 port adapter provides up to eight EIA/TIA-232 synchronous serial interfaces through a single port that has a 200-pin, Molex receptacle. Each interface provides full-duplex operation at the rate of 64 kbps. The synchronous serial EIA/TIA-232 port adapters are available for Cisco 7500 series, Cisco 7000 series, and Cisco 7200 series routers.

The Token Ring port adapters provide IBM Token Ring or IEEE 802.5 Token Ring interfaces. Each Token Ring interface can be set for 4 Mbps or 16 Mbps. All Token Ring ports run at line (wire) speed. The Token Ring port adapters are available for Cisco 7500 series, Cisco 7000 series, and Cisco 7200 series routers.

The half-duplex FDDI port adapters provide a half-duplex interface for both single-mode and multimode fiber-optic cable. The two physical ports (PHY A and PHY B) are available with either single-mode (SC) or multimode (MIC) receptacles. Each port adapter's FDDI connection allows a maximum bandwidth of 100 Mbps per the FDDI standard. Both FDDI port adapters provide half-duplex operation only and optical bypass switching capability. The half-duplex FDDI port adapters are available for Cisco 7500 series, Cisco 7000 series, and Cisco 7200 series routers.

The full-duplex FDDI port adapters provide a fiber-optic interface. The two physical ports (PHY A and PHY B) are available with either single-mode (SC) or multimode MIC receptacles. Each port adapter's FDDI connection allows a maximum bandwidth of 100 Mbps, per the FDDI standard for half-duplex operation, and 200 Mbps aggregate bandwidth with full-duplex operation enabled. Both FDDI port adapters provide optical bypass switching capability. The full-duplex FDDI port adapters are available for Cisco 7500 series, Cisco 7000 series, and Cisco 7200 series routers.

Table 20 lists the port adapter and service adapter product numbers for the Cisco 7000 family.
| Description | Product Number |
|---|---|
| 1 ATM (OC-3 rate) single-mode intermediate reach, single-width port | PA-A1-OC3SM |
| 1 ATM (OC-3 rate) multimode, single-width port | PA-A1-OC3MM |
| 4-port ISDN BRI port adapter for the Cisco 7200 with ISDN services using the "U" interface | PA-4B-U |
| 8-port ISDN BRI port adapter for the Cisco 7200 with ISDN services using the "S/T" interface | PA-8B-S/T |
| 2-port ISDN PRI and channelized T1 serial port adapter | PA-2CT1/PRI |
| 2-port ISDN PRI and channelized E1 serial port adapter, 75 ohms, unbalanced | PA-2CE1/PRI-75 |
| 2-port ISDN PRI and channelized E1 serial port adapter, 120 ohms, balanced | PA-2CE1/PRI-120 |
| 4 Ethernet 10BaseT ports | PA-4E |
| 8 Ethernet 10BaseT ports | PA-8E |
| 5 Ethernet 10BaseFL ports | PA-5EFL |
| 1 Fast Ethernet 100BaseTX port | PA-FE-TX |
| 1 Fast Ethernet 100BaseFX port | PA-FE-FX |
| 4 synchronous serial ports supporting EIA/TIA-232, EIA/TIA-449, EIA-530, X.21, and V.35, enhanced version | PA-4T+ |
| 8 synchronous serial ports supporting V.35 | PA-8T-V35 |
| 8 synchronous serial ports supporting X.21 | PA-8T-X21 |
| 8 synchronous serial ports supporting EIA/TIA-232 | PA-8T-232 |
| 4 Token Ring ports, half-duplex | PA-4R |
| 4 Token Ring ports, full-duplex | PA-4R-FDX |
| 1 half-duplex FDDI multimode | PA-F-MM |
| 1 half-duplex FDDI single-mode | PA-F-SM |
| 1 full-duplex FDDI multimode | PA-F/FD-MM |
| 1 full-duplex FDDI single-mode | PA-F/FD-SM |
